Stackable Battery Lithium Iron Phosphate Battery
- Features & Benefits
1. High cycle life
>6000 cycles @80% DOD for effectively lower total cost of ownership2. Longer service life
Low-maintenance batteries with stable chemistry. Easily monitor state of charge (SOC) of smart models.3. Built-in circuit protection
Battery Management Systems (BMS) are incorporated against abuse.4. Better storage
Up to 6 months thanks to its extremely low self-discharge (LSD) rate and no risk of sulphation.5. Quickly recharge
Save time and increase productivity with less downtime thanks to superior charge/discharge efficiency.6. Extreme heat tolerance
Suitable for use in a wider range of applications where ambient temperature is unusually high: up to +60°C.7. Lightweight
Lithium batteries provide more Wh/Kg while also being up to 1/3 the weight of its SLA equivalent. - Applications
Lithium Iron Phosphate can be used in most applications that use
Lead Acid, GEL or AGM type batteries. Suitable applications include:
• Caravan
• Marine
• Golf Car
• Buggies
• Solar Storage
• Remote Monitoring
• Switching applications and more - Cautions
• Do NOT short circuit, crush or disassemble.
• Do NOT heat or incinerate.
• Do NOT immerse in any liquid.
• Store at 50% capacity. Recharge every 3 months. The storage area should be clean, cool, dry and ventilated.
Product Parameters

| ELECTRICAL PERFORMANCE | |
| Nominal Voltage | 51.2V |
| Nominal Capacity | 100 Ah |
| Capacity @20A | 300 min |
| Energy | 5120 Wh |
| Resistance | ≤20 mΩ@50%SOC |
| Self Discharge | <3%/Month |
| Cells | LFP Cell 3.2V |
| CHARGE PERFORMANCE | |
| Recommended Charge Current | 20 A |
| Maximum Charge Current | 100 A |
| Charge Cut-Off Voltage | 58.4 V |
| Reconnect Voltage | >56V |
| Balancing Voltage | <54.4V |
| Protocol(optional) | RS485//CAN |
| LED display | (Optional) |
| DISCHARGE PERFORMANCE | |
| Continuous Discharge Current | 100 A |
| Maximum Continuous Discharge Current | 105-110 A |
| Peak Discharge Cut-Off Current | 300 A(5~15 ms) |
| Discharge Cut-Off Voltage | 40V |
| Reconnect Voltage | >44.8V |
| Short Circuit Protection | 200~800 μs |
| MECHANICAL PERFORMANCE | |
| Dimension (L×WxH) | 600×450×220 mm |
| Approx.Weight | About 43±2kg |
| Terminal Type | M8 |
| Terminal Torque | 80~100 in-Ibs(9~11 N-m) |
| Case Material | Metal |
| Enclosure Protection | IP20 |
| TEMPERATURE PERFORMANCE | |
| Discharge Temperature | -4~140 F(-20~60 ℃) |
| Charge Temperature | 32~113 F(0~55℃) |
| Storage Temperature | 23~95 °F(-5~35℃) |
| High Temperature Cut-Off | 149F(65℃) |
| Reconnect Temperature | 118F(48℃) |
| COMPLIANCE | |
| Certifications | CE
UN38.3 UL1973&IEC62619 |
| Shipping Classification | UN 3480, CLASS 9 |

6-GFM(G)-100 12V 100Ah/10Hr Gel Valve Regulated Lead-Acid Battery
- 6-GFM(G)-100 12V 100Ah Gel Valve Regulated Lead-acid Battery is a high-capacity energy storage battery with a rated voltage of 12V and a rated capacity of 100Ah (10-hour rate). It can continuously provide reliable power under stable discharge conditions. The 10Hr capacity standard means that this battery can continuously output its rated capacity within a 10-hour discharge cycle, making it suitable for energy storage, backup power, and long-term power supply systems.
- This battery utilizes gel electrolyte (Gel) technology and a valve-regulated sealed (VRLA) structure. The electrolyte is fixed in a gel state, preventing flow or leakage, making the battery safer and more stable while reducing maintenance requirements. Compared to traditional liquid lead-acid batteries, gel batteries offer better deep-cycle capability and a longer lifespan.
- Cyclic charging voltage: 14.4V – 14.8V
- Float charging voltage: 13.6V – 13.8V
- Maximum initial charging current: ≤30A
- This charging method ensures stable battery performance in both cyclic use and standby power modes, while preventing overcharging or overheating, thus extending battery life. Many 12V 100Ah gel batteries can achieve hundreds to thousands of cycles under proper charging conditions.

6-GFM(G)-55 12V 55Ah/10Hr Gel Valve Regulated Lead-Acid Battery
- 12V 55Ah/10Hr Gel Valve Regulated Rechargeable Lead-acid Battery is a valve-regulated sealed lead-acid battery (VRLA) using gel electrolyte technology. It features maintenance-free operation, safety, stability, and a long service life, and is widely used in energy storage, power backup systems, and communication equipment.
- This battery has a rated voltage of 12V and a rated capacity of 55Ah (10-hour rate), meaning it can stably provide 55 amp-hours of charge under 10-hour discharge conditions. Utilizing gel electrolyte (Gel) technology, the electrolyte is fixed within a silicone structure, effectively preventing electrolyte stratification and leakage, thus improving battery safety and stability. Compared to traditional liquid lead-acid batteries, gel batteries exhibit better performance and a longer cycle life under deep-cycle conditions.
- The product employs a valve-regulated sealed structure design, eliminating the need for electrolyte replenishment during normal use, achieving truly maintenance-free operation. It also features an internal safety valve that automatically releases gas when the internal pressure of the battery becomes too high, ensuring safe and reliable battery operation.
